For symmetrical acceleration a is given by this formula where v is the velocity of the object and r is the object’s distance from the center of the circular path a=v to the 2nd power over r solve for r

Answer:


r=(v^2)/(a)

Explanation:


a=(v^2)/(r) \\ \\ ar=v^2 \\ \\ r=(v^2)/(a)
